The Royal Tombs in Nuku'alofa are a significant historical site, serving as the final resting place for Tongan royalty. Visitors can explore the beautifully maintained grounds and learn about the rich cultural heritage of Tonga.

Overview

The Royal Tombs are a key historical site in Tonga, offering a glimpse into the nation's royal heritage. The well-preserved tombs and surrounding grounds provide a peaceful setting for reflection and learning. Visitors can appreciate the cultural significance and architectural beauty of this sacred site.

Exploring the Royal Tombs in Nuku'alofa, Tonga

Nestled in the heart of Nuku'alofa, Tonga, the Royal Tombs stand as a solemn tribute to the rich heritage and history of the Tongan monarchy. These tombs are the final resting places of the kings and queens who have shaped the nation’s identity over centuries. For frequent travellers and history enthusiasts planning a trip to Nuku'alofa, Tonga, visiting the Royal Tombs offers a unique glimpse into the island's regal past and cultural depth. Situated conveniently within the city, the Royal Tombs are easily accessible and provide a budget-friendly activity for those exploring Nuku'alofa.

Historical Significance

The Royal Tombs hold great historical importance as the burial site of Tongan royalty. They reflect the deep cultural and spiritual traditions of Tonga and are a symbol of national pride.

Family Friendly

The Royal Tombs are family-friendly, with open spaces for children to explore. However, parents should supervise kids to ensure respectful behavior at this sacred site.

Getting There

The Royal Tombs are easily accessible by car or taxi from Nuku'alofa. Public transportation options are limited, so planning ahead is recommended.
